Wylie Real Estate
Wylie is a rapidly growing suburb on the eastern edge of Collin County, offering a small-town feel with proximity to Lake Lavon. Known for its strong school district and affordable homes, Wylie attracts families looking for Collin County quality at a more accessible price point.

Why Live in Wylie?
- Wylie ISD is highly rated with growing campuses and programs
- More affordable than western Collin County cities like Frisco and Prosper
- Lake Lavon provides boating, fishing, and outdoor recreation
- Small-town community feel with rapid growth bringing new amenities

Frequently Asked Questions
Is Wylie affordable compared to other Collin County cities?
Yes. Wylie offers Collin County schools and quality of life at prices significantly below Frisco, Prosper, and McKinney, making it popular with young families.
What outdoor activities are near Wylie?
Lake Lavon is minutes away, offering boating, fishing, kayaking, and lakeside parks. The city also has an extensive local park system.
How far is Wylie from Dallas?
Wylie is about 30 miles northeast of downtown Dallas, roughly 30-40 minutes by car via US-75 or the George Bush Turnpike.
